The American Heart Association and Additional Ventures have announced a combined $20 million commitment to address critical gaps in care for individuals with single ventricle heart disease, specifically those who have undergone the Fontan procedure. This collaborative effort aims to improve the ability to predict, prevent, and treat long-term health complications associated with Fontan circulation, a surgically created circulatory system for patients born with only one functional heart ventricle.
Single ventricle heart disease affects approximately 6 in 10,000 babies born in the United States each year. While the Fontan procedure is lifesaving, it places chronic strain on the body, leading to progressive damage across multiple organs, including the liver, kidneys, and lungs. Currently, clinicians lack reliable methods to monitor Fontan health, often resulting in patients appearing stable until they experience severe, sometimes fatal, complications.
The six-year, multi-phase program will bring together clinicians, researchers, and patients to generate scientific insights and develop clinical tools. The initiative leverages the American Heart Association's research infrastructure, guideline development, and registry science, combined with Additional Ventures' expertise in single ventricle disease strategy and network. The goal is to move from reactive care to proactive health monitoring, creating a foundation for future standards of care.
“People with Fontan circulation often develop complications with other organs in the body including the liver, kidneys and lungs,” said Mariell Jessup, M.D., FAHA, chief medical and science officer of the American Heart Association. “The coordination between our two organizations will generate data and insight that can help patients and clinicians better monitor their health and intervene earlier.”
Kirstie Keller, PhD, chief executive officer of Additional Ventures, emphasized the need for better understanding: “While lifesaving, Fontan circulation creates complex, lifelong health challenges for single ventricle heart disease patients that we still do not fully understand. Through this collaboration, we will work with researchers, clinicians and patients to generate the scientific insights and tools needed to predict, detect and manage complications earlier.”
The initial phase will evaluate current monitoring approaches, identify gaps in care and data, and engage stakeholders in program design.
